CVE-2023-43202 : Vulnerability Insights and Analysis

Discover the command injection vulnerability in D-LINK DWL-6610 FW_v_4.3.0.8B003C, enabling attackers to execute arbitrary commands. Learn about mitigation and prevention steps.

A command injection vulnerability in D-LINK DWL-6610 FW_v_4.3.0.8B003C has been discovered, allowing attackers to execute arbitrary commands.

Understanding CVE-2023-43202

This CVE identifies a critical security flaw in the D-LINK DWL-6610 firmware version 4.3.0.8B003C, which enables threat actors to run unauthorized commands through a specific parameter.

What is CVE-2023-43202?

The CVE-2023-43202 reveals a command injection vulnerability in D-LINK DWL-6610 FW_v_4.3.0.8B003C. It permits hackers to execute arbitrary commands by exploiting a particular parameter within the firmware.

The Impact of CVE-2023-43202

The impact of this vulnerability is severe as it grants malicious actors the ability to run unauthorized commands on the affected device, potentially leading to unauthorized access, data theft, or further compromise.

Technical Details of CVE-2023-43202

This section provides an overview of the vulnerability's description, affected systems and versions, as well as the exploitation mechanism.

Vulnerability Description

The vulnerability exists in the function pcap_download_handler, allowing attackers to execute arbitrary commands through the update.device.packet-capture.tftp-file-name parameter.

Affected Systems and Versions

The affected system is the D-LINK DWL-6610 with firmware version 4.3.0.8B003C. Any system running this specific firmware version is susceptible to exploitation.

Exploitation Mechanism

Threat actors can exploit this vulnerability by manipulating the update.device.packet-capture.tftp-file-name parameter, injecting malicious commands to be executed by the system.

Mitigation and Prevention

Learn how to mitigate the risks associated with CVE-2023-43202 and prevent potential security breaches by following the steps below.

Immediate Steps to Take

To address the vulnerability, update the D-LINK DWL-6610 firmware to a secure version that patches the command injection issue. It is essential to regularly check for firmware updates and apply them promptly.

Long-Term Security Practices

Implementing network segmentation, access controls, and regular security audits can bolster your overall security posture and reduce the risk of similar vulnerabilities being exploited in the future.

Patching and Updates

Stay vigilant for security advisories from D-LINK regarding firmware updates. Timely patching is critical to safeguarding your devices against known vulnerabilities.
